Homosexuality as a Deviant Social Condition

# 66317
An examination of the attitudes to homosexuality today.
1,348 words (approx. 5.4 pages) | 4 sources | MLA | 2006 | United States
Published on: Jun 07, 2006

Paper Summary:

This paper identifies sexuality of all kinds all around us, on the Internet, on movie posters, on radio "shock-jock" programs and on street corners where people of all genders attempt to sell their bodies to pay for rent or drugs.The author states that despite all this supposed openness, where even America's president has admitted a dalliance in the Oval Office, the idea of homosexuality as acceptable behavior still eludes the majority of Americans.The paper concludes that although homosexuality is more common it is still not accepted as it should be.
